2 Affect: is almost always a verb; it means ‘to influence’ Affect: is almost always a verb; it means ‘to influence’ Effect: is most often used as a noun and means “the result” Effect: is most often used as a noun and means “the result”

5 There, their, They’re Their- is a possessive pronoun, one that shows ownership Their house is on the next block. There- is an adverb that tell where Please meet us at the church over there at 2:00 p.m. They’re- is the contraction for ‘they are’ They’re coming over for dinner this evening.

7 Loose and lose Loose- means ‘free or untied”. These jeans are too loose in the waist. Lose- means to misplace or to fail to win. Georgia did lose to Alabama. Put away your books before you lose them.

13 Allusion An allusion is a brief reference to, or mention of, a famous person, place, thing, or idea. (Copy this on to your Literature Terms paper) What allusion is used in Stargirl in this chapter?
